The Importance of Flexibility in Daily Life and Performance

In today’s fast-paced world, many individuals spend long hours sitting, which can lead to tight muscles and restricted movement patterns. This not only affects posture but also limits functional movement, making everyday tasks more challenging. On the other hand, athletes and performers rely on flexibility to execute complex movements with precision and control. A well-rounded flexibility program helps bridge the gap between static postures and dynamic activity, ensuring the body remains adaptable and resilient.

Consider a yoga practitioner who regularly engages in stretching routines. Their ability to maintain balance and perform intricate poses is directly tied to their flexibility. Similarly, a dancer requires supple joints and relaxed muscles to move fluidly across the stage. These real-world examples highlight how flexibility isn’t just about being “limber”—it's about enhancing overall physical efficiency.

Effective Flexibility Training Methods

There are several approaches to flexibility training, each with its own advantages and applications. Dynamic stretching, static stretching, and proprioceptive neuromuscular facilitation (PNF) are among the most widely used techniques. Understanding when and how to apply each method can significantly impact progress.

Dynamic stretching involves controlled, repetitive movements that mimic the actions of a specific activity. For instance, a runner might perform leg swings or high knees before a race to warm up the muscles and increase blood flow. This method is particularly effective for preparing the body for physical exertion.

Static stretching, by contrast, focuses on holding a stretch for an extended period—usually 15 to 30 seconds. It is ideal for post-workout recovery, as it helps reduce muscle tension and promote relaxation. However, it should be approached with caution if done before intense activity, as it may temporarily decrease muscle power.

PNF, often considered the gold standard for improving flexibility, combines stretching and contraction of the target muscle group. Techniques like contract-relax or hold-relax are commonly used in rehabilitation settings to restore mobility after injury. This method is especially beneficial for those looking to achieve significant gains in range of motion.

Practical Tips for Maximizing Flexibility Gains

To get the most out of flexibility training, consistency is key. Aim for at least two to three sessions per week, focusing on major muscle groups and common problem areas such as the hips, hamstrings, and shoulders. Listening to your body is equally crucial—pushing too hard too soon can lead to strain or injury.

Using props like resistance bands, foam rollers, or yoga blocks can enhance the effectiveness of stretches while reducing the risk of overextension. Additionally, maintaining proper breathing throughout each stretch helps relax the muscles and deepen the stretch.

Finally, consider working with a qualified instructor or using guided resources such as online tutorials or apps. Professional guidance can help ensure correct form and prevent bad habits from forming.
